Transaction 732630f0a01db1059ed2d53ac4c9e39afaa4599311ceb864eb45e5f064334148
1 Input
1 Output
-
732630f0a01db1059ed2d53ac4c9e39afaa4599311ceb864eb45e5f064334148:0
- value
- 429267
- script pubkey
- OP_0 OP_PUSHBYTES_20 c575e3ecba0d6237c5834e5c863a37808542aabf
- address
- bc1qc4678m96p43r03vrfewgvw3hszz5924lmmxav6